Line Mode Browser

维基百科,自由的百科全书
(差异) ←上一修订 | 最后版本 (差异) | 下一修订→ (差异)
跳转到导航 跳转到搜索
Line Mode Browser
File:LineModeBrowser.gif
Line Mode Browser显示德语维基百科
Line Mode Browser显示德语维基百科
原作者
开发者W3CCERN
首次发布0.7,1991年5月14日,​35年前​(1991-05-14[1]
当前版本5.4.1(2006年12月4日,​19年前​(2006-12-04[2]
源代码库
  • {{URL|example.com|可选的显示文本}}
Module:EditAtWikidata第29行Lua错误:attempt to index field 'wikibase' (a nil value)
编程语言C[3]
引擎
    Module:EditAtWikidata第29行Lua错误:attempt to index field 'wikibase' (a nil value)
    类型网页浏览器
    许可协议W3C软件声明和授权条款英语W3C Software Notice and License
    网站www.w3.org/LineMode/

    Line Mode Browser(也称为LMB[4]、WWWLib或者www[5])是世界上第二个网页浏览器[6]。该浏览器是首个被证明可移植至数种不同操作系统的浏览器[7][8]。通过简单的命令行界面操作,使其能广泛应用于互联网上许多电脑与电脑终端。该浏览器自1990年开始开发,随后由万维网联盟维护,作为Libwww函数库的示例与测试应用程序[9]

    历史[编辑]

    1990年,蒂姆·伯纳斯-李编写了第一款浏览器WorldWideWeb,但该程序仅能运行于NeXT电脑的专有软件上,而该电脑的使用范围有限[7]。柏内兹-李及其团队无法将具备图形化所见即所得编辑器等功能的WorldWideWeb浏览器移植到更广泛部署的X Window系统,因为他们缺乏相关的程序设计经验[10]。团队招募了在CERN实习的数学系学生尼古拉·佩洛[11],编写一个功能极为基础的浏览器,使其能在当时的大多数电脑上执行[7]。Line Mode浏览器之名源于其为了确保与电传打字机等早期电脑终端兼容,该程序仅显示文字,且仅具备逐行文字输入功能[10][12]

    开发工作始于1990年11月,并于1990年12月进行演示[13]。由于开发时间紧迫,软件采用了C语言的一种简化方言,因为当时官方标准ANSI C尚未在所有平台上普及[10]。1991年3月,Line Mode浏览器在当时主流的各种大型机系统上小规模发表[14]。柏内兹-李于1991年8月在Usenet的alt.hypertext新闻组宣布了该浏览器[15][16]。用户可以从互联网任何地方通过Telnet协议连线至info.cern.ch服务器(这也是史上第一台网页服务器)来使用此浏览器。随着1991年关于万维网的消息逐渐传开,CERN以及德国DESY等其他实验室也开始对此项目产生浓厚兴趣[7][17][18]

    Line Mode浏览器在网络发展初期非常流行,因为这是当时唯一适用于所有操作系统的网页浏览器。1994年1月的统计数据显示,Mosaic已迅速改变了网页浏览器的格局,仅剩2%的用户仍使用Line Mode浏览器[19]。纯文字网页浏览器的市场随后被Lynx取代,这使得Line Mode浏览器的地位逐渐被边缘化,原因之一是Lynx比Line Mode浏览器灵活得多[20]。此后,它便成为Libwww的测试应用程序。

    参考文献[编辑]

    1. ^ Berners-Lee, Tim. Change History of Line Mode Browser. World Wide Web Consortium. 23 April 1998 [2 June 2010]. (原始内容存档于2016-03-04). 
    2. ^ Bancroft, Vic. libwww/ChangeLog. World Wide Web Consortium. 4 December 2006 [7 November 2015]. (原始内容存档于2021-08-17). 
    3. ^ Pellow, Nicola. LM_Availability – /Talk_Feb-91. World Wide Web Consortium. February 1991 [10 August 2010]. (原始内容存档于2016-03-03). 
    4. ^ Nielsen, Henrik Frystyk. How can I download a Document?. World Wide Web Consortium. April 1995 [10 August 2010]. (原始内容存档于2012年1月12日). 
    5. ^ Bolso, Erik Inge. 2005 Text Mode Browser Roundup. Linux Journal. 8 March 2005 [5 August 2010]. (原始内容存档于2010-02-24). 
    6. ^ Berners-Lee, Tim. Frequently asked questions – What were the first browsers?. World Wide Web Consortium. [26 July 2011]. (原始内容存档于2018-10-03). 
    7. ^ 7.0 7.1 7.2 7.3 Ten Years Public Domain for the Original Web Software. CERN. 30 April 2003 [21 July 2005]. (原始内容存档于2017-06-29). 
    8. ^ How the web began. CERN. 2008 [25 July 2010]. (原始内容存档于2013-01-18). 
    9. ^ Nielsen, Henrik Frystyk. WWW – The Libwww Line Mode Browser. World Wide Web Consortium. 4 May 1998 [9 June 2010]. (原始内容存档于2020-09-24). 
    10. ^ 10.0 10.1 10.2 Petrie, Charles; Cailliau, Robert. Interview Robert Cailliau on the WWW Proposal: "How It Really Happened.". Institute of Electrical and Electronics Engineers. November 1997 [18 August 2010]. (原始内容存档于6 January 2011). 
    11. ^ Berners-Lee, Tim; Fischetti, Mark. Weaving the Web需要免费注册. HarperSanFrancisco. 1999: 29. ISBN 9780062515865. [...] we needed help. Ben Segal [...] spotted a young intern named Nicola Pellow. 
    12. ^ Stewart, Bill. Web Browser History. Living Internet. [2 June 2010]. (原始内容存档于2011-01-20). 
    13. ^ Cailliau, Robert. A Little History of the World Wide Web. World Wide Web Consortium. 1995 [7 August 2010]. (原始内容存档于2013-05-06). Technical Student Nicola Pellow (CN) joins and starts work on the line-mode browser. 
    14. ^ Crémel, Nicole. A Little History of the World Wide Web. CERN. 5 April 2001 [2 June 2010]. (原始内容存档于19 December 2007). 
    15. ^ Stewart, Bill. Tim Berners-Lee, Robert Cailliau, and the World Wide Web. Living Internet. [26 July 2010]. (原始内容存档于2018-04-02). 
    16. ^ Berners-Lee, Tim. Re: Qualifiers on Hypertext links.... 6 August 1991 [28 July 2010]. (原始内容存档于2022-09-13). We have a prototype hypertext editor for the NeXT, and a browser for line mode terminals which runs on almost anything. 
    17. ^ Gillies, James; Cailliau, Robert. How the Web Was Born. Oxford University Press. 2000: 205. ISBN 0-19-286207-3. 
    18. ^ Berners-Lee, Tim. Public Domain CERN WWW Software. 7 May 1993 [11 October 2010]. (原始内容存档于2010-10-25). 
    19. ^ History of the Web. Oxford Brookes University. 2002 [20 November 2010]. (原始内容存档于25 September 2010). 
    20. ^ Graham, Ian S. The HTML Sourcebook: The Complete Guide to HTML. John Wiley & Sons. 1995: 323. ISBN 0-471-11849-4.